And Andy Warhol, gay artist and Pop Art icon, transformed everyday images into art – just as this image shows queer love in front of a fairytale castle.\u003c\/p\u003e\u003ch2\u003eLudwig II – The Gay King and his Fairytale Castle\u003c\/h2\u003e\u003cp\u003eNeuschwanstein Castle was built by \u003cstrong\u003eKing Ludwig II of Bavaria\u003c\/strong\u003e – a man who never married, escaped into art and music, and whose homosexuality is historically documented. Ludwig II was inspired by Richard Wagner's operas and created Neuschwanstein as a sanctuary full of romance, beauty, and dreams.\u003c\/p\u003e\u003cp\u003eThe fact that two men are kissing in front of this castle is no coincidence – it is an \u003cstrong\u003ehomage to queer history\u003c\/strong\u003e. Ludwig II could not live his love openly. Warhol himself was gay and part of New York's LGBTQ+ scene in the 1960s\/70s.\u003c\/p\u003e\u003cp\u003eIn 1987, shortly before his death, Warhol painted a series about Neuschwanstein Castle. He reinterpreted the fairytale castle in his typical Pop Art style – vibrant colors, graphic contours, silkscreen aesthetics. Warhol recognized: Neuschwanstein is not just a building, but an \u003cstrong\u003eicon\u003c\/strong\u003e – just like Marilyn Monroe or the Campbell's soup can. A symbol of dreams, romance, and the American dream of the European fairytale. For everyone who wants an image with attitude.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eThis image belongs on the wall of people who understand that freedom is never given – it is taken.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cblockquote\u003e\n\u003ch3\u003eAbout the Stonewall Protests (June 28, 1969)\u003c\/h3\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eIn the early morning hours of June 28, 1969, the New York City police raided the Stonewall Inn, a bar on Christopher Street in Greenwich Village. Such raids were routine – gay bars were regularly raided, patrons arrested, humiliated, abused. But that night, the patrons fought back. The protests lasted for three days. Stonewall became a symbol of queer resistance and the birthplace of the modern LGBTQ+ movement. A year later, the first Pride March took place – as a remembrance of Stonewall, as a celebration of resistance.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003c\/blockquote\u003e\n\u003ch2\u003eTechnical Details\u003c\/h2\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eAvailable as a high-quality art print in various sizes. A picture that is not quiet.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\n\u003cp\u003e\u003cstrong\u003e\u003ca href=\"\/en-eu\/blogs\/news\/glad\" title=\"Glad to Be Gay – Die Geschichte hinter dem Song\"\u003eRead the story behind the song →\u003c\/a\u003e\u003c\/strong\u003e\u003c\/p\u003e\n\n\u003ch2\u003e1978 – When Punk Became Political\u003c\/h2\u003e\n\n\u003cp\u003eThe Tom Robinson Band was part of the Rock Against Racism movement. \"Glad to Be Gay\" denounced: police raids on gay bars, tabloid press vilification, societal hypocrisy. The song was not a plea for acceptance. It was a declaration of war.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\n\u003cp\u003eThis mural continues that attitude. For anyone who doesn't hide their sexuality.
